Responsibilities
- Own and execute irrigation and feeding strategies across all cultivation zones and flower rooms.
- Validate pH/EC targets through runoff monitoring, system checks, and in-room inspections.
- Monitor, review, and document irrigation data, measurements, and observations.
- Manage nutrients, fertilizer, and chemical inventory
- Maintain fertigation equipment, filters, mix tanks, and irrigation lines on established schedules.
- As a Lead Fertigation Technician at Curaleaf, you'll own irrigation and nutrient delivery across the cultivation facility, ensuring systems, schedules, and execution are consistent, proactive, and aligned with crop needs.
- Manage nutrients, fertilizer, and chemical inventory; ensure tanks are stocked and weekend-ready.
